About the Internship:

Ministry of External Affairs is launching the second edition of the MEA Internships Programme for the year 2023-24. The second edition of the program is aimed towards continuing the aim of the Ministry to bring in more focus on MEA to provide value to the interns; to ensure better gender inclusivity and to increase diversity in terms of qualifications, domicile, and socio-economic status amongst the cohort of interns engaged by the Ministry.

Intake and duration:

  • Every year, internships will be offered in two terms of six months each viz. April to September and October to March.
  • A maximum of 30 interns will be engaged by the Ministry during each term. Each intern will be engaged for a minimum period of one month and a maximum period of three months.

Obligations of the intern:

  • The internship program provides an introduction to the process of formulation of foreign policy and its implementation by the Government of India. Interns will be assigned specific topics of work by the concerned Head of Division (HOD) and may be required to conduct research, write reports, analyze evolving developments, or carry out any other task entrusted to them by the HOD.
  • At the end of the internship, each intern shall submit a detailed report on the work carried out and, if required, make a presentation on it. The outcome of the study during the internship will remain as intellectual property of the Ministry of External Affairs and interns shall not use it without prior approval of the Ministry. The intern shall maintain full confidentiality of any information relating to the Ministry of External Affairs

Salary & benefits

An honorarium of INR 10,000 per month will be paid to each intern to defray basic costs. Cost of one-time to and for air travel subject to a ceiling of the prevailing economy class airfare between the State capital and Delhi, from the domicile State or the college/university of the selected candidates will be provided. The interns would be responsible for their boarding and lodging in Delhi during the period of their internship.

About you

Eligibility criteria:

  • Internships at MEA headquarters shall generally be open to Indian citizens with a minimum educational qualification of a graduate degree from a recognized university at the time of applying.
  • Internships shall also be open to students who are presently in the final year of their graduation, where an internship is a mandatory part of their final-year curriculum.
  • The age of the candidates should not exceed 25 years as of 31 December of the year of internship.
